THIS IS A SOURCES SOUGHT NOTICE ONLY. THIS IS NOT A REQUEST FOR PROPOSAL. The Department of Veterans Affairs, VHA, Network Contracting Office (NCO) 19 Rocky Mountain Acquisition Center is seeking potential sources that are capable of providing clinical laboratory analyzer(s), supplies, materials, equipment, and services necessary to perform immunology and immunoassays for ANA Screens, Syphilis IgG and RPR, Measles/Mumps/Rubella/Varicella, Herpes Simplex virus (HSV) antibodies, Cytomegalovirus (CMV) antibodies, Epstein-Barr Virus (EBV) antibodies, Vasculitis Panel, Anti-CCP Panel, Celiac Panels, Antiphospholipid Panels, 5th Generation HIV Antibody Panel and Toxoplasma on a Cost per Reportable Result (CPRR) basis, on a single platform (single equipment), for the following VISN 19 VA medical facility:
VA Oklahoma City Medical Center at 921 NE 13th Street, Oklahoma City, OK, 73104, Department of Pathology and Laboratory.
NCO 19 is performing market research to determine if there is a sufficient number of qualified (1) Service-Disabled Veteran Owned Small Business (SDVOSB); (2) Veteran Owned Small Business (VOSB); (3) Small or emerging small business firms; or (4) Large businesses who can fulfill the requirement. This Sources Sought notice is issued for the purpose of market research in accordance with Federal Acquisition Regulation (FAR) Part 10. All SDVOSB, VOSB, small and large businesses capable of fulfilling the requirement are invited to respond.
NAICS code to be used for this acquisition is 334516. All interested firms who can meet the requirements stated in Summary of Requirements below should respond, in writing, with the following information:
Interest and Capabilities
Address and UEI
Business category (SDVOSB, VOSB, Small Business, or Large Business)
State if interested firm has a NAC or GSA contract by replying with their applicable contract number
Price Structure: Provide information on how pricing is structured (i.e. Cost per Reportable Result, Cost per Test, Analyzer rental and reagent purchase, or Reagent Rental (analyzer rental costs included in reagent costs).
Any information submitted by respondents to this sources sought synopsis is voluntary. This sources sought notice is not to be construed as a commitment by the Government, nor will the Government reimburse any costs associated with the submission of information in response to this notice. Respondents will not individually be notified of the results of any Government assessments.
Responses and questions may be submitted electronically to:
Juanita.Street@va.gov and NCO19Services2@va.gov in a Microsoft word compatible format no later than Thursday, February 9th, 12:00pm Mountain Time. PHONE CALLS NOT ACCEPTED.
SUMMARY OF REQUIREMENTS:
Both autoimmune and infectious disease immunity tests must be on a single platform (single analyzer/equipment). If a vendor cannot provide all tests in a single platform DO NOT RESPOND TO THIS SOURCES SOUGHT NOTICE.
Tests to be on single platform/equipment are: ANA Screens, Syphilis IgG and RPR, Measles/Mumps/Rubella/Varicella, Herpes Simplex virus (HSV) antibodies, Cytomegalovirus (CMV) antibodies, Epstein-Barr Virus (EBV) antibodies, Vasculitis Panel, Anti-CCP Panel, Celiac Panels, Antiphospholipid Panels, 5th Generation HIV Antibody Panel and Toxoplasma
Analyzer must be fully automated.
Analyzer must have random access capability.
Testing must be provided on a Cost per Reportable Result, Cost per Test, Analyzer rental and reagent purchase, or Reagent Rental (analyzer rental costs included in reagent costs) basis which includes the usage of the analyzer, reagents, supplies, equipment, maintenance, repair, software, and training all bundled in a single cost (CPRR, CPT, Analyzer rental and Reagent purchase, or Reagent Rental).
